Costs

When estimating the cost of replacing windows homeowners should consider the material and style of their windows. There are a variety of other factors that impact costs, such as whether they'd like energy-efficient windows, specific window treatments, and more. The more customizations that homeowners want to create, the more expensive their price.

Retrofit installations can lower the cost of window replacements for homeowners by using frames and trims instead having to replace them. This is not a good option for older homes or ones with significant damage to their trim and frames. The style of window frame influences the overall cost of the project. Aluminum frames can cost $75 to $400 per window. Wood is more expensive, but more durable than aluminum. Vinyl frames are inexpensive and easy to maintain, however they don't insulate as well as other materials. Composite frames, which combine wood fibers with polymers in order to provide the durability of wood, without the need for maintenance, are one of the most durable and energy-efficient alternatives at between $700 and $1200 per window.

Windows last on average 20-30 years. In this time, they must provide insulation and protect from hot or cold temperatures. As time passes, they may start to get worse and lose their effectiveness. This could lead to drafts and expensive energy bills. If your windows show signs of wear, or aren't as effective in decreasing energy costs or noise it is recommended to replace them.

They will assist you in deciding whether you'd prefer a full-frame window replacement or retrofit. A full-frame replacement would involve taking out the entire frame and sash. On the other hand, retrofit installations will just replace the sash.
